might try the upper Potomac, from DC south to Indian Head but the recent heavy rains have muddy the water and alot of debris arround. might also check-out the Northeast river or the Sasafrass, both are above Connawingo(sp) so the water should be cleaner and less debris....oh, also the upper Chester river around Chestertown and the upper part of the Choptank, but again due to the rains, these rivers might still be a bit dis-colored.
